@media only screen and (max-width: 1680px) {}
@media only screen and (max-width: 1600px) {}
@media only screen and (max-width: 1440px) {
.sepi_texto,
.cta_subtitulo {
font-size: 14px;
line-height: 22px;
} 
.sepi_titulo{
font-size: 26px;  
}
.sepi_titulo_2 {
font-size: 22px;
}
.sepi_titulo_3,
.relacionados_titulo {
font-size: 20px;
}
.organiza_box .box .box_texto {
font-size: 12.5px;
line-height: 22px;
}
.relacionados_subtitulo,
.cta_chamado {
font-size: 18px;
}
.cta_botao.btn_animacao span {
font-size: 12.5px;
}
.organiza_box .box .box_texto.titulo_curso {
font-size: 15px;
}
.box_texto_curso {
font-size: 13px;
line-height: 28px;
}
}
@media only screen and (max-width: 1366px) {}
@media only screen and (max-width: 1280px) {}
@media only screen and (max-width: 1200px) {}
@media only screen and (max-width: 1080px) {}
@media only screen and (max-width: 1024px) {
#sepi_intro {
padding: 86px 0 46px;
}
#sepi_intro .content {
-ms-flex-direction: column;
-webkit-box-direction: normal;
-webkit-box-orient: vertical;
flex-direction: column;
min-width: 90%;
width: 100%;
}
#sepi_intro .box_esq,
#sepi_intro .box_dir {
padding: 0px 40px;
width: 100%;
}
#sepi_intro .content_full {
min-width: 90%;
width: 100%;
padding: 0px 40px;
margin-top: 60px;
}
#relacionados .content,
#sepi_cta .content {
min-width: 90%;
width: 100%;
}
#relacionados .content {
padding: 0px 40px;
}
#resultados {
background-image: url(//zixbe.com/wp-content/themes/gestao-de-processos/transformacao-digital/home/consultoria-de-processos_resultado_banner_mobile.webp);
padding: 75px 0px;
}
#resultados .content {
-ms-flex-align: center;
-ms-flex-direction: column;
-webkit-box-align: center;
-webkit-box-direction: normal;
-webkit-box-orient: vertical;
align-items: center;
flex-direction: column;
gap: 75px;
min-width: 90%;
width: 100%;
}
.organiza_resultado {
-ms-flex-direction: column;
-webkit-box-direction: normal;
-webkit-box-orient: vertical;
flex-direction: column;
gap: 30px;
}
.sepi_titulo {
font-size: 28px;
}
.sepi_texto {
font-size: 14px;
line-height: 24px;
margin-bottom: 30px;
}
.margin_sembox {
margin-bottom: 40px;
}
#sepi_intro .box_dir {
margin-top: 40px;
justify-content: center;
align-items: center;
}
.sepi_titulo_2 {
font-size: 24px;
}
.sepi_titulo_3 {
font-size: 22px;
}
.organiza_box .box .box_texto {
font-size: 13.5px;
line-height: 24px;
}
.organiza_box {
flex-wrap: wrap;
gap: 30px;
justify-content: center;
margin-bottom: 40px;
}
.organiza_box .box,
.organiza_box .box.box_curso {
width: calc(50% - 15px);
}
.organiza_resultado .titulo {
font-size: 28px;
text-align: center;
}
.organiza_resultado .descricao {
font-size: 18px;
margin-top: 10px;
}
#sepi_cta .content {
flex-direction: column;
padding: 0 40px;
}
#sepi_cta .box_esq,
#sepi_cta .box_dir {
padding: 0;
width: 100%;
}
#sepi_cta {
padding: 60px 0;
}
.cta_subtitulo {
text-align: center;
font-size: 16px;
}
.cta_titulo {
text-align: center;
font-size: 36px;
line-height: 46px;
margin-bottom: 40px;
}
.cta_chamado {
font-size: 18px;
margin-bottom: 30px;
}
.cta_botao.btn_animacao span {
font-size: 14px;
}
.organiza_relacionados {
gap: 30px;
}
#relacionados {
padding: 60px 0;
}
.organiza_relacionados .box_relacionado {
width: calc(50% - 15px);
padding: 30px;
}
.organiza_relacionados .box_relacionado:nth-child(n+4) {
margin-top: 0%;
}
.relacionados_titulo {
font-size: 22px;
line-height: 32px;
margin-bottom: 40px;
}
}
@media only screen and (max-width: 996px) {}
@media only screen and (max-width: 768px) {}
@media only screen and (max-width: 600px) {
#sepi_intro,
#relacionados {
padding: 40px 0;
}
#sepi_intro .box_esq,
#sepi_intro .box_dir,
#sepi_intro .content_full,
#relacionados .content,
#sepi_cta .content {
padding: 0px 18px;
}
.organiza_box .box,
.organiza_box .box.box_curso {
width: 100%;
}
.organiza_relacionados .box_relacionado {
width: 100%;
}
}
@media only screen and (max-width: 490px) {}
@media only screen and (max-width: 460px) {}
@media only screen and (max-width: 430px) {
.cta_subtitulo {
font-size: 15px;
}
.cta_titulo {
font-size: 32px;
line-height: 40px;
}
.cta_chamado {
font-size: 16px;
}
.sepi_titulo {
font-size: 24px;
}
.sepi_titulo_2 {
font-size: 21px;
}
.sepi_titulo_3 {
font-size: 19px;
}
}
@media only screen and (max-width: 400px) {}
@media only screen and (max-width: 360px) {}
@media only screen and (max-width: 330px) {}
@media only screen and (max-width: 280px) {}